Hannah May Atkinson Davis, 78, of Malad, passed away Saturday, September 9, 1995 in the Oneida County Nursing Home. She was born May 5, 1917 in Samaria, Idaho, a daughter of Alfred Henry and Hannah Elizabeth Waldron Atkinson. She grew up and was educated in Samaria. On March 9, 1938 she married Samuel “Bud” Jones Davis in St. John Idaho, and their marriage was later solemnized in the Logan Utah LDS Temple on February 17, 1965. Since 1938 Hannah and her husband had lived in St. John, where they farmed and ranched. Mr. Davis died December 10, 1983. She was an active member of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ints., and has served in the Relief Society, was a teacher in Sunday School and YWMIA, and was Sunday School secretary. She was a member of the Arcadia Club. She enjoyed gardening and yard work.

She is survived by two sons and their wives, Gary T. and Carole Davis of Las Vegas, Nevada; 10 grandchildren and nine great-grandchildren; one brother, William Atkinson, and one sister, Viney Evans, both of Malad.

Funeral services were held Wednesday, September 13, 1995 in ST. John Ward. Burial was in the St. John Cemetery.
